# GovernClaw Middleware
This skill provides **governed wrappers** for sensitive operations. It acts as a policy enforcement layer between agents and external systems.
## When to Use This Skill
**You MUST use governed tools from this skill instead of raw tools when:**
- Calling external HTTP APIs (`governedHttp` instead of `http`)
- Running shell commands (`governedShell` - future)
- Reading/writing files (`governedFile` - future)
- Controlling a browser (`governedBrowser` - future)
## How It Works
1. You call a governed tool (e.g., `governedHttp`)
2. The skill sends your request metadata to GovernClaw for policy evaluation
3. GovernClaw returns `allow` or `block` with a reason
4. If allowed: the underlying operation executes and returns results
5. If blocked: the operation is cancelled and you receive a block reason
## Available Tools
### governedHttp
Makes HTTP requests through the GovernClaw policy engine.
**Parameters:**
- `method` (string): HTTP method - "GET", "POST", "PUT", "DELETE"
- `url` (string): Target URL
- `body` (object, optional): Request body for POST/PUT
- `headers` (object, optional): Custom headers
**Returns:**
- On success: The HTTP response from the target
- On block: `{ ok: false, blocked: true, reason: "..." }`
**Example:**
```typescript
const result = await context.tools.governclawMiddleware.governedHttp({
method: "GET",
url: "https://api.example.com/data"
});
if (result.blocked) {
// Handle policy block
console.log("Blocked:", result.reason);
}
```
## Configuration
Set the GovernClaw service URL in your environment:
```bash
export GOVERNCLAW_URL="http://127.0.0.1:8000"
```
Or in `openclaw.json`:
```json
{
"skills": {
"governclaw-middleware": {
"env": {
"GOVERNCLAW_URL": "http://127.0.0.1:8000"
}
}
}
}
```
## Governance Context
The skill automatically forwards these context fields to GovernClaw:
- `parent_id`: The session ID (who owns the request)
- `child_id`: The agent ID (who is making the request)
- `source`: Where the request originated (agent, control, cron, etc.)
- `channel`: The channel ID (if applicable)
- `node_id`: The node ID (if applicable)
- `skill`: Always "governclaw-middleware"
## Error Handling
Always check for `blocked` in responses:
```typescript
const response = await context.tools.governclawMiddleware.governedHttp({...});
if (!response.ok && response.blocked) {
// Policy violation - do not retry
return { error: response.reason };
}
if (!response.ok) {
// Network or other error - may retry
return { error: "Request failed" };
}
// Success
return response.data;
```
## Policy Modes
GovernClaw supports three governance modes:
- **playground**: Log-only, actions always allowed
- **governed**: Default mode, enforce policies
- **strict**: Block on any uncertainty
